Transaction 62a1f49f4dc811bc4ad1f544dc7227d2f84c676c54c57e8355f8755c2e41ffba

1 Input
2 Outputs
  • 62a1f49f4dc811bc4ad1f544dc7227d2f84c676c54c57e8355f8755c2e41ffba:0
  • value  134585009
    address  3APmQeqok5xhmRBPapxTD4t3afFKK36ndt
  • 62a1f49f4dc811bc4ad1f544dc7227d2f84c676c54c57e8355f8755c2e41ffba:1
  • value  1036436
    address  34ozhQCWdEJWcH9H9Zv23mC8dySS12DxaD